[Boston] 1776 Jany 15
It was now agreed between the Generals and the Admiral that the Kitty Transport should go to New York with General [Henry] Clinton under Convoy of the Mercury and that the Falcon should proceed to Cape Fear alone. And the Admiral having acquainted Rear Admiral Shuldham that he should on the Morrow direct him to take all the Kings Ships to the Southward of Boston under his Command, sent Captains Graeme and [John] Linzee Orders to wait upon him for his Dispatches thither, and directed Captain Linzee to proceed without the Kitty Transport and to return her sealed Rendezvous, she being put under the Convoy of Captain Graeme.
